Transaction 4955886c4910043a7faa3f5e29f312363e0cb5d903a15efa588d1a916d61a121

1 Input
2 Outputs
  • 4955886c4910043a7faa3f5e29f312363e0cb5d903a15efa588d1a916d61a121:0
  • value  44613487
    address  3CvmbRCQrhksoUjvf7Hn3w9uqfojzPk7St
  • 4955886c4910043a7faa3f5e29f312363e0cb5d903a15efa588d1a916d61a121:1
  • value  22707995
    address  1Eo6yJDtt96yFwVMXLptx9GbfKpFkKSJ9a